The Nutritional Powerhouse: Vitamins, Minerals, and More!
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: fruits are nutritional powerhouses! They're like nature's multivitamin, offering a wide array of essential nutrients that your body craves. We're talking about vitamins, minerals, and a whole host of other beneficial compounds. First up, vitamins! Fruits are brimming with vitamins like Vitamin C, crucial for boosting your immune system and protecting your cells from damage. Think oranges, strawberries, and kiwis. Then there's Vitamin A, found in abundance in fruits like mangoes and cantaloupe, which is vital for vision and skin health. Fruits also provide B vitamins, which are key for energy production and nerve function. Now, let's talk about minerals. Fruits are good sources of minerals such as potassium, which helps regulate blood pressure and supports muscle function, and manganese, which is important for bone health and metabolism. Not only this, but Fruits are also packed with fiber, which aids in digestion and helps you feel full, promoting weight management. And let's not forget the antioxidants! These compounds fight off free radicals in your body, protecting your cells from damage and reducing the risk of chronic diseases. Antioxidants are particularly high in berries and other brightly colored fruits. Eating a variety of fruits ensures you're getting a well-rounded intake of these vital nutrients. Vitamin C and Antioxidants: Your Body's Best Friends
Vitamin C and antioxidants are like the dynamic duo when it comes to fruit's benefits. Vitamin C is a water-soluble vitamin that acts as a powerful antioxidant, protecting your cells from damage caused by free radicals. Free radicals are unstable molecules that can contribute to aging and diseases like cancer and heart disease. Vitamin C helps neutralize these free radicals, keeping your cells healthy. Think of it as a shield against harmful invaders. You can find high levels of Vitamin C in citrus fruits like oranges and grapefruits, as well as in berries and kiwis. Now, let's talk about antioxidants, which are found in almost all fruits. These compounds are also critical in fighting off free radicals. Different fruits contain different types of antioxidants, so eating a variety of fruits ensures you're getting a broad spectrum of protection. For instance, berries are packed with antioxidants like anthocyanins, which give them their vibrant colors and are great for brain health. Antioxidants help reduce inflammation, which is linked to many chronic diseases. Fiber and Hydration: Keeping Things Moving Smoothly
Beyond vitamins and antioxidants, fiber and hydration are major advantages of fruit consumption. Fiber is a type of carbohydrate that the body can't digest, but it's essential for maintaining good digestive health. It adds bulk to your stool, preventing constipation, and it helps you feel full, which can aid in weight management. Fruits like apples, pears, and berries are excellent sources of fiber. Fiber also helps regulate blood sugar levels by slowing down the absorption of sugar, which is particularly beneficial for people with diabetes or those at risk of developing it. Now, let's talk about hydration. Fruits have a high water content, which makes them a great way to stay hydrated. Water is crucial for almost every bodily function, from transporting nutrients to regulating body temperature. Fruits like watermelon, cantaloupe, and strawberries are especially hydrating. Heart Health and Blood Pressure: Keeping Your Engine Running
Let’s dive into how fruits can support heart health and blood pressure! Fruits are your heart's best friends. The fiber in fruits, particularly soluble fiber, helps lower levels of LDL (bad) cholesterol, which is a major risk factor for heart disease. Furthermore, fruits provide nutrients that support heart health in various ways. Potassium, found in fruits like bananas, helps regulate blood pressure. High blood pressure is a significant risk factor for heart disease, and potassium helps counteract the effects of sodium, which can raise blood pressure. Fruits also contain antioxidants that protect the blood vessels from damage and reduce inflammation, which can contribute to heart disease. Studies have shown that people who eat plenty of fruits and vegetables have a lower risk of heart disease. Eating a diet rich in fruits is associated with a reduced risk of stroke and other cardiovascular issues. The vitamins and minerals in fruits, along with their high water content, contribute to overall heart health. The fiber, antioxidants, and vitamins in fruits work together to keep your cardiovascular system running smoothly. Natural Energy Boost: Ditch the Crash and Burn
Let's talk about natural energy boosts! Fruits are a fantastic alternative to those sugary snacks and energy drinks that often lead to a quick burst of energy followed by a crash. Fruits provide a sustained energy release. They contain natural sugars like fructose, which are absorbed more slowly due to the fiber content. This means you get a steady stream of energy, rather than a sudden spike and crash. The vitamins and minerals in fruits also play a vital role in energy production. B vitamins, for instance, are essential for converting the food you eat into energy. Fruits also provide electrolytes, such as potassium, which can help replenish your energy levels, especially after exercise. Unlike processed foods that offer empty calories, fruits provide essential nutrients that support your overall health and energy levels.
